Business Analyst/Quality Assurance Analyst II
The Regional Income Tax Agency is looking for a Business Analyst/Quality Assurance Analyst II to join their team. This role will serve as the primary liaison between project teams and stakeholders, leading IT development initiatives and ensuring successful solution implementations.

Responsibilities
Lead assigned projects by facilitating discovery sessions with product owners and stakeholders, translating requirements into detailed user stories and story boards, conducting grooming sessions with the development team and coordinating activities to ensure successful project delivery
Partners with stakeholders and cross-functional teams to assess, prioritize, and refine business requirements for optimal project alignment
Effectively works on multiple concurrent projects with a strong focus on time management to meet tight deadlines and deliverables
Utilizes Azure DevOps for end-to-end management of user stories, tasks, bugs, and sprints, ensuring transparency and traceability across project teams
Elicits, documents, and analyzes detailed business and functional requirements to support the successful execution of projects of varying scopes and complexity
Translates conceptual business needs into user stories, workflows, and specifications that are clear and actionable for technical teams
Acts as a liaison between business users and Information Services teams, facilitating cross-functional collaboration
Collaborates with project sponsors to define project scope, vision, and deliverables to ensure alignment with organizational goals
Communicates changes and enhancements to business requirements — both verbally and in written documentation — to the project team, ensuring clear understanding of issues and solutions
Executes manual and automated test cases for both new and existing features to ensure software quality and functionality
Performs comprehensive testing, including functional, integration, security, data conversion, stress/performance, and user acceptance testing
Identifies, documents, and tracks software defects through to resolution
Participate in monthly patch testing, integration testing, smoke testing, and production support to maintain system stability and performance
Ensures all software meets organizational quality standards prior to deployment
Creates procedure documentation and knowledgebase articles
Performs demonstrations for end users to showcase new software functionality and gather feedback for continuous improvement
Communicates technology solutions into clear, concise language for non-technical stakeholders

Black box Testing: Does the product work as it is supposed to?
Grey box Testing: Do various parts of the products architecture work, e.g., interfaces, APIs?
White Box Testing: Using BA/QA developed code/scripts/queries, do the various parts of the product architecture work as expected?
